🚨 5 Illegal Ways Hackers Make Money – Part 2: Rubber Ducky Ever seen a USB drive lying around in an office, reception, or public place? It might not be as harmless as it looks. A device called Rubber Ducky looks exactly like a normal pen drive, but when plugged into a computer it behaves like a keyboard and can automatically execute pre-programmed commands in seconds. ⌨️⚡️ Because it works at superhuman typing speed, most users don’t even notice what just happened.
